Allah's statement, ﴿ظˆظژط¥ظگظ†ظ’ ط£ظژط·ظژط¹ظ’طھظڈظ…ظڈظˆظ‡ظڈظ…ظ’ ط¥ظگظ†ظ‘ظژظƒظڈظ…ظ’ ظ„ظژظ…ظڈط´ظ’ط±ظگظƒظڈظˆظ†ظژ﴾ (and if you obey them, then you would indeed be polytheists.) means, when you turn away from Allah's command and Legislation to the saying of anyone else, preferring other than what Allah has said, then this constitutes Shirk. Allah said in another Ayah, ﴿ط§طھظ‘ظژط®ظژط°ظڈظˆط§ظ’ ط£ظژطظ’ط¨ظژظ€ط±ظژظ‡ظڈظ…ظ’ ظˆظژط±ظڈظ‡ظ’ط¨ظژظ€ظ†ظژظ‡ظڈظ…ظ’ ط£ظژط±ظ’ط¨ظژط§ط¨ط§ظ‹ ظ…ظ‘ظگظ† ط¯ظڈظˆظ†ظگ ط§ظ„ظ„ظ‘ظژظ‡ظگ﴾ (They (Jews and Christians) took their rabbis and their monks to be their lords besides Allah.)﴿9:31﴾ In explanation of this Ayah, At-Tirmidhi recorded that `Adi bin Hatim said, "O Allah's Messenger! They did not worship them.'' The Prophet said, آ«ط¨ظژظ„ظژظ‰ ط¥ظگظ†ظ‘ظژظ‡ظڈظ…ظ’ ط£ظژطظژظ„ظ‘ظڈظˆط§ ظ„ظژظ‡ظڈظ…ظڈ ط§ظ„ظ’طظژط±ظژط§ظ…ظژ ظˆظژطظژط±ظ‘ظژظ…ظڈظˆط§ ط¹ظژظ„ظژظٹظ’ظ‡ظگظ…ظڈ ط§ظ„ظ’طظژظ„ظژط§ظ„ظژ ظپظژط§طھظ‘ظژط¨ط¹ظڈظˆظ‡ظڈظ…ظ’ ظپظژط°ظژظ„ظگظƒظژ ط¹ظگط¨ظژط§ط¯ظژطھظڈظ‡ظڈظ…ظ’ ط¥ظگظٹظ‘ظژط§ظ‡ظڈظ…آ» (Yes they did. They (monks and rabbis) allowed the impermissible for them and they prohibited the lawful for them, and they followed them in that.
